Abstract
The progress of a project for the training of e-learning professionals in South East Asia is reported in this paper. A Web-based survey identified key areas for the professional development. The process of content design is explained as well as the enrichment of the pedagogical model. The Virtual Training Environment is underpinned by this model and the potential role of learning objects is consequently discussed.
